Manchester City star Yaya Toure has boosted his side's chances in the Premier League title race with his sole contribution in their gritty 1-0 win over Stoke City on Saturday at the Etihad Stadium.
Manuel Pellegrini's team looked to be frustrated in much of the game having managed just one point from their previous two league matches.
However, Sport24 reports that with 20 minutes left, Toure touched in from a couple of yards to keep City, who lost substitute Stevan Jovetic to injury, three points behind leaders Chelsea with a game in hand.
The defeat stretched Stoke's run of away league matches without a win to 12, the report added.
